Description Mattias Dahlberg 2002-07-10 08:31:25 UTC
Description of problem:
I didn't choose any game groups (GNOME games, KDE games , X games, etc.) but 
nevertheless I got around 40 games installed, with corresponding icons in the 
program menu.

I don't know if this is general problem with the package selection, but I only 
noticed it regarding to the games.



How reproducible:
Always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Install Red Hat Beta Limbo
2. Don't select any games packages
3. Later check for installed games

Comment 3 Mattias Dahlberg 2002-07-10 19:28:27 UTC
Could the reason be that I selected all the different development package 
groups and that some package in there had a dependency on the games?

Comment 4 Michael Fulbright 2002-07-18 17:36:54 UTC
Very likely.

Comment 5 Jeremy Katz 2002-07-18 19:36:05 UTC
Yes, some of the games packages leaked into the development groups.  These have
been fixed since.

Comment 6 Mike McLean 2002-07-18 22:13:22 UTC
Not quite fixed.  I'm still getting kde-games with Milan-re0718.0.  Although
gnome-games is gone.  I will attach some details.

# rpm -qa |grep game
kdegames-3.0.2-1
kdegames-devel-3.0.2-1

Comment 9 Mike McLean 2002-07-18 22:17:26 UTC
Hmm, maybe it's unavoidable.

# rpm -e --test kdegames
error: Failed dependencies:
        kdegames = 3.0.2-1 is needed by (installed) kdegames-devel-3.0.2-1
